## Brindlewick Environments: Cron Migration

All scheduled jobs in Brindlewick are being moved from host crontabs to the Quillrun workflow engine. Staging has been fully migrated; production still runs three legacy crons pending the March cutover. Future maintainers should add new schedules only in Quillrun — crontab edits will be overwritten by provisioning. The staging scheduler uses the following configuration values.

deployment values, yadup-kadug:
[sorys]
port = 5672
team = noveth
host = sorys.orvexcorp.example
region = south-4
access_code = ac_deddc1
timeout_ms = 1500

### Escalation: Cartwheel Scanner Integration

If the Cartwheel barcode bridge reports sustained decode failures (more than 5% over 15 minutes), first confirm the Lumenport gateway is healthy and firmware checksums match the signed manifest. Any checksum mismatch is treated as a potential tampering event and must skip normal triage. Capture the device log bundle before rebooting. Send the bundle and your findings to the escalation queue.

escalation mailbox, hadug-bajog: sormir@norvalabs.internal

## Introduce per-tenant rate quotas in the Orvane gateway

For the release manager: this change replaces our global throttle with per-tenant quotas, resolved at request time from the tenant registry and cached for sixty seconds. Tenants without an explicit quota inherit the tier default; overage returns a retryable status with a hint header. Rollout is gated behind a flag, defaulting off, and the old throttle remains as a backstop until two clean release cycles pass.

The initial tier defaults we intend to ship are listed below.

limits module of taguf-hafog:
WEIGHTS = {
    "wenox": 690,
    "wenok": 782,
    "kelax": 41,
    "holox": 338,
    "quenir": 39,
}

### v4.8.2 — Key rotation

Heads up, support: we rotated the signing key for the Ordella service that handles soft deletes in the orders table. Nothing changes for customers — deleted orders still hide, not vanish, and restores work the same. If a partner's webhook verification starts failing after today, point them at the new key. It's the one below.

signing key of bagap-yawep = bky13_TbfT6ZMUoGJo2